What Services Do Concrete Companies Offer?
Concrete Pouring
Concrete companies can pour several types of structures, such as new patios and driveways. First, the company chooses a durable concrete mix suitable for Seguin's climate. Then, contractors will pour the concrete so that it sets evenly, and use techniques such as vibration to ensure strength and uniformity.
Concrete Cleaning
Professional cleaning enhances both the look and lifespan of concrete. The contractor will scrub the affected areas with a cleaning solution to lift the grime. They may also use pressure washing depending on the area—it's a good option for concrete driveways, patios, and sidewalks.
Concrete Sealing
Sealing concrete helps defend it from UV radiation, water, freezing, and other kinds of damage. Sealing concrete can help you save money in the long run by extending your concrete's lifespan. It’s important to have a professional seal concrete, as an expert can guarantee the sealant goes on evenly and attaches properly.
Concrete Reinforcement
When adding or upgrading a concrete driveway, patio, or walkway, contractors can bolster it with steel bars or meshes. The added framework absorbs stress from heavy loads and vibrations.
Concrete Repair
Concrete can weaken over time due to improper installation, weather damage, or normal wear and tear. A concrete professional can evaluate and repair cracking, spalling, or eroding on concrete driveways, walkways, and more. Techniques like patching, resurfacing, epoxy injections, and rebar replacement can restore functionality, appearance, and strength to distressed areas. This saves you from having to redo the whole structure.
Cost of Concrete Services in Seguin
While your cost will depend on your specific job, our research shows Seguin concrete services cost around $3–$7* per square foot and $95–$106 per cubic yard.
Project | $ Range |
---|---|
Patio | $1,621 - $5,064 |
Driveway | $4,051 - $7,596 |
Foundation Repair | $2,532 - $7,596 |
Retaining Wall | $14 - $17 per sq face ft |
General Repair | $422 - $2,110 |
*Costs sourced from multiple 2022 reports, including those from Concrete Network and LawnStarter.
How To Choose a Concrete Professional
Review Portfolios
Request a portfolio of the concrete contractor's past work pouring, finishing, and restoring concrete. The contractor's project history can help you determine whether you'd like to work with them or not.
Check Licensing and Insurance
Concrete licenses are regulated locally in Texas, so check your municipality's regulations. Always verify that your contractor is properly bonded and insured, in case any injuries or property damage happen.
Look for Trade Group Memberships
Membership in a trade organization shows that the contractor is committed to quality work and continued improvement. Examples of concrete trade organizations are the American Concrete Pavement Association (ACPA) or the American Society of Concrete Contractors (ASCC).
Read Customer Reviews
Companies with a history of happy customers tend to provide high-quality customer service. Look at customer reviews on websites such as Trustpilot and the Better Business Bureau (BBB) and ask people you know for recommendations.
Compare Multiple Quotes
Ask for a detailed quote from a minimum of three contractors. This helps you get an idea of the average price in Seguin for your project type. Ensure the estimates break down both labor and material costs, and be cautious of anyone giving extremely high or low rates.
Ask About Warranties
Ask what warranties your provider offers for both labor and materials. Make sure to get all warranty information in writing.
